Furniture specialist Sleep Number ($SNBR) faces a severe financial crisis, yet persistent insider buying is sending mixed signals to investors. With shares at $7.14, down 56% from $16.22 a year ago, the paradoxical buying behavior of executives and major shareholders is drawing attention. Sleep Number, founded in 1987 and based in Minnesota, is a smart bed manufacturer selling adjustable mattresses and related sleep solutions through 630 stores nationwide. The company competes with Purple Innovation and Leggett & Platt in the smart furniture market, leveraging unique technology to secure a niche position. The most shocking moment came on March 5, 2025, with Q4 earnings. Revenue fell 12.3% year-over-year to $376.82 million, significantly missing analyst expectations, causing shares to plummet 39% in a single day. Q2 2025 results were even worse, with revenue declining 19.7% to $327.93 million and per-share losses of $1.09, nine times worse than the expected $0.12 loss. The company currently holds just $1.35 million in cash, extremely low relative to its $173 million market cap. Same-store sales have plunged 20%, and operating margins have collapsed to 0%. Under these circumstances, investors are expressing serious concerns about Sleep Number's survival. However, insider actions tell a completely different story. Insider buying that began in August 2024 continues today. Particularly notable is Stadium Capital Management's aggressive purchasing. This major shareholder invested over $4 million from October 31 to November 18, 2024, continuously buying shares when prices were in the $13-14 range. More intriguing is the timing of executive purchases. CEO Linda Kozlowski invested $750,000 to buy 104,520 shares on May 7-8, 2025, when shares had plummeted to the low $7 range. Former CFO Francis Lee also bought $50,000 worth during the same period. Most recently, on August 1, interim CFO Robert Ryder purchased 15,000 shares at $6.83. This insider buying pattern can be interpreted two ways. First, executives who know the company's fundamentals well may believe current shares are severely undervalued. Second, it could be symbolic gestures aimed at restoring market confidence. Industry experts point to Sleep Number's structural problems. As consumer furniture purchasing patterns rapidly shift online, Sleep Number's offline-centric business model is showing limitations. The company closed 16 stores over the past year as part of cost-cutting efforts, but this also means reduced customer touchpoints. There are key metrics investors should watch. First, cash burn rate - with just $1.35 million in cash, the company can only survive a few months without additional funding or massive cost cuts. Second, same-store sales improvement - if the 20% decline continues, the company may reach an irreversible point. Third, online channel growth rate - how much online sales can compensate for offline store revenue declines. In a positive scenario, if insiders are correct, current share prices may be oversold due to excessive fear. The smart bed market still has growth potential, and Sleep Number's technology and brand recognition could serve as a foundation for recovery. Aggressive restructuring could also improve profitability. In a negative scenario, bankruptcy risks from cash depletion could materialize. If consumer economic downturn persists, demand for expensive mattresses will further contract, and intensifying competition could lead to market share losses. Analyst price targets currently range from $6.50-8.00, with most maintaining 'hold' ratings. This reflects a cautious view that complete abandonment is premature despite extreme uncertainty.
